The ability of donor–acceptor cyclopropanes to
(3 + 3)-cyclodimerize
is disclosed. It has been found that Lewis acid-induced transformations
of 2-(hetero)arylcyclopropane-1,1-dicarboxylates containing electron-abundant
aromatic substituents led to the construction of six-membered cyclic
systems. Depending on the substrate properties and the Lewis acid
applied, three types of products can be obtained: (1) 1,4-diarylcyclohexanes,
(2) 1-aryl-1,2,3,4-tetrahydronaphthalenes, and (3) 9,10-dihydroanthracenes.
